As the Pfizer-Allergan merger talks heat up, shining yet another spotlight on the tax inversion issue, a Goldman Sachs report notes that it is up to the U.S. Treasury and IRS to stem flood of corporations fleeing the U.S. tax system for more friendly climates abroad.
